Wagtail Content Stream

An abstract Django model with a Wagtail StreamField named body with multiple blocks I use on a regular basis. This is geared towards developers who need to write examples with code in them. It's opinionated: very little HTML is allowed in the text block, forcing authors to create structured data. The following blocks are included in ContentStreamBlock:

  • Heading
  • Paragraph
  • Captioned Image
  • Embed
  • Table
  • Code Block

A secondary StreamBlock, ContentStreamBlockWithRawCode, also provides an additional block for injecting HTML, JS, and CSS code. Use with care, as this can really blow up your markup and is a potential code injection point!

Three pages types are provided out-of-the-box.

Example Usage

You will need to add wagtailcodeblock to your INSTALLED_APPS Django setting.

Basic Usage: a Title Field and Content Stream

First, create a page type in your models.py:

from wagtailcontentstream.models import ContentStreamPage, SectionContentStreamPage, ContentStreamPageWithRawCode

class StandardPage(ContentStreamPage):
    pass

class SectionStandardPage(SectionContentStreamPage):
    pass

class StandardPageWithRawCode(ContentStreamPageWithRawCode):
    pass

Then in your template:

{% load wagtailcore_tags %}

<h2>{{ page.title }}</h2>
{% include_block page.body %}

Extended Usage: Adding More Fields

from django.conf import settings
from django.db import models
from wagtail.admin.edit_handlers import FieldPanel
from wagtailcontentstream.models import ContentStreamPage


class StandardPage(ContentStreamPage):
    date = models.DateField("Post Date")
    authors = models.ManyToManyField(settings.AUTH_USER_MODEL)

    content_panels = [
        FieldPanel('date'),
        FieldPanel('authors'),
    ] + ContentStreamPage.content_panels
